Etymology

[edit]

Learnedly from τοποθετώ (topothetó) +‎ -ση (-si).[1]

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/to.poˈθe.ti.si/
  • Hyphenation: το‧πο‧θέ‧τη‧ση

Noun

[edit]

τοποθέτηση (topothétisif (plural τοποθετήσεις)

  1. positioning, placement, placing (the action by which something is placed)
  2. placement (the act of matching a person with a job)
  3. installation
  4. position (an opinion, stand or stance)
